Abraham had more than one wife Genesis , some were called concubines. Jacob was tricked into polygamy Genesis and later received two additional wives bringing the grand total of four wives Genesis , 9. Esau took a third wife to please his father Isaac Genesis Ashur had two wives 1 Chronicles Obadiah, Joel, Isshiah, and those with them had multiple wives 1 Chronicles Caleb had two wives 1 Chronicles and two concubines 1 Chronicles , Gideon had many wives Judges Elkanah is recorded as having two wives, one of whom was the godly woman Hannah 1 Samuel , David had at least 8 wives and 10 concubines 1 Chronicles ; 2 Samuel , Solomon had wives and concubines 1 Kings Rehoboam had eighteen wives and sixty concubines 2 Chronicles and sought many wives for his sons 1 Chronicles Abijah had fourteen wives 2 Chronicles Ahab had more than one wife 1 Kings Jehoram had multiple wives 2 Chronicles Jehoiada the priest gave king Joash two wives 2 Chronicles Jehoiachin had more than one wife 2 Kings Clearly, polygamy—at least among wealthy and powerful men—was common and brought little condemnation from God or His prophets.

The silence of God does not connote approval, however. Just because something is mentioned in the Bible does not mean that it is approved. For example, God permitted divorce because of the hard hearts of the people cf Matt , but to permit reluctantly is not to endorse or be pleased. Consider some of the following internecine conflicts and tragedies:. Rachel was infertile for many years, but finally gave birth to Joseph and later Benjamin. The brothers hatched a plot to kill Joseph, but due to a combination of their desire for monetary gain and the intervention of Reuben, he was instead sold into slavery.

At the root of this sad story of this bitter conflict was a polygamous mess. Gideon had many wives and by them many sons. Scripture tells the story of violence and death that resulted from this situation, with the sons all competing for kingship and heritage.

Now Gideon had seventy sons, his direct descendants, for he had many wives. His concubine who lived in Shechem also bore him a son, whom he named Abimelech. At a good old age Gideon, son of Joash, died and was buried in the tomb of his father Joash in Ophrah of the Abiezrites. Abimelech, son of Jerubbaal i. He then went to his ancestral house in Ophrah, and slew his brothers, the seventy sons of Jerubbaal Gideon , on one stone. Only the youngest son of Jerubbaal, Jotham, escaped, for he was hidden Judges At the heart of this murderous conflict was polygamy.

Life — and especially love — among human beings is never easy. Though our story is complicated by the fact that two sisters share one husband something that the Torah later forbids , the truth is that even in monogamous relationships, life is often not simple. The Torah is insightful because it lets us know that families have been struggling with these issues for thousands of years.

Perhaps, in some small way, we can better our family lives by seeing the struggles of our ancestors and trying to learn from them. Provided by the Jewish Theological Seminary, a Conservative rabbinical seminary and university of Jewish studies.
